How Laminate Flooring Is Installed: A Step-by-Step Guide

Laminate flooring offers the look of hardwood with durable, budget-friendly construction. Proper installation is essential to maximize durability and appearance. This guide explains how laminate flooring is installed, focusing on a typical floating installation over an appropriate underlayment. It covers preparation, subfloor prep, acclimation, layout, cutting, click-lock assembly, and finishing touches. Following these steps helps homeowners achieve a professional result with common tools and minimal downtime.

Preparation And Planning

Proper preparation sets the foundation for a durable laminate installation. Measure the room, calculate board quantity with a 5-10% waste allowance, and decide the layout direction. Align planks parallel to the primary light source or along the longest wall to reduce visible seams.

Acclimate the laminate in the installation space for 48-72 hours per manufacturer instructions; inspect the subfloor, remove existing coverings if possible, and repair any high spots or squeaks. Gather tools, safety gear, and materials, and plan transitions to adjacent rooms.

Required Tools And Materials

A typical laminate installation relies on a concise toolkit and the right materials. The following list covers essentials used for most projects.

  • Measuring tape
  • Utility knife
  • Miter saw or circular saw
  • Spacers
  • Tapping block and pull bar
  • Hammer or mallet
  • Level or straightedge
  • Underlayment (if not pre-attached)
  • Laminate planks
  • Moisture barrier or vapor retarder (for concrete slabs)
  • Pry bar
  • Safety gear (gloves, goggles)

Subfloor Preparation

A flat, clean surface ensures long-lasting results. Clear the room of debris, remove nails or staples, and sweep thoroughly. Check for moisture and repairs: loose boards or squeaks should be fixed, and any high spots leveled with a suitable patch or leveling compound.

For wood subfloors, fasten or secure panels to eliminate movement; for concrete, ensure it is fully cured and dry. If the surface is not flat within 3/16 inch (about 5 mm) over a 10-foot span, level it before installation. These steps reduce follow-on issues like creaking, gaps, or uneven seams.

Underlayment And Moisture Considerations

The underlayment serves as a dampening layer and can improve comfort underfoot. Many laminates use a foam or cork underlayment, and some planks include an attached layer.

In basements or concrete slabs, a dedicated moisture barrier is often required. If the subfloor is concrete, install a moisture barrier along with the underlayment to slow moisture transfer and protect the laminate. Follow manufacturer guidelines for thickness, compression, and compatibility with the chosen laminate system.

Layout And Expansion Gaps

Determine the plank direction before cutting; aligning with light sources or along the longest wall typically gives the best appearance. Plan to minimize narrow end cuts by adjusting layout across the room.

Maintain a perimeter expansion gap to allow for wood expansion and contraction. Use spacers to keep a consistent gap along walls; typical gaps range from 1/4 inch to 1/2 inch (6–12 mm), depending on product width and environmental conditions. Baseboards or moldings will cover these gaps later.

Installing The Laminate

Laminate is installed as a floating floor that snaps together without glue or nails in most systems. The following steps describe a typical process, with attention to alignment and stability.

  1. Lay the first row along the starting wall, placing spacers to maintain the expansion gap. Ensure the tongue faces the direction you are building toward.
  2. Place the second row such that its end joint is offset from the first row by at least 6–12 inches to enhance stability and appearance.
  3. Continue adding rows, snapping boards together with the click-lock mechanism. Use a tapping block and pull bar to snug joints without damaging edges.
  4. When you reach walls or obstacles, measure carefully and cut planks to fit. Save cut pieces for the opposite end of the next row to maximize material usage.
  5. Maintain consistent joints and avoid over-tightening; rapid impact can chip edges. Periodically check for levelness as you progress.
  6. Install the last row, often cutting boards to fit and ensuring the remaining width accommodates the expansion gap. If space is tight, trim the planks with a miter saw to the exact width required.

Floating Floor Assembly

Click-lock planks interlock along their length and width, creating a single, floating surface that rests on the underlayment. Do not glue or nail the boards to the subfloor unless a product specifies otherwise. This approach allows for natural expansion and contraction with humidity and temperature changes.

Finishing Touches And Transitions

After the floor is laid, remove spacers and install baseboards or quarter-round molding to cover expansion gaps and provide a finished look. Use appropriate transition pieces (T-molding, reducers, or end caps) at doorways and where the laminate meets other flooring materials. If doors were removed, rehang them and trim as needed to clear the new floor height.

Inspect the surface for gaps, loose edges, or uneven seams and correct as necessary. Finally, clean the floor with manufacturer-approved products to protect the wear layer and keep the surface looking uniform.

Tips And Common Pitfalls

  • Don’t skip acclimation or place laminate in a space with extreme humidity before installation.
  • Always verify subfloor flatness and moisture levels before laying planks.
  • Reserve spare pieces for future repairs and ensure matching batch numbers to avoid color variation.
  • Avoid water exposure during installation and cleaning; use a damp mop rather than a soaking wipe.
  • Follow manufacturer instructions for expansion gaps, especially for large rooms or spaces with underfloor heating.
  • Mix planks from multiple cartons during installation to ensure a natural, varied appearance.
